On Awaken The Sleeping Giant, New York emcee Queen Herawin delivers a cathartic blend of stunning tales of personal growth with raw, speaker-shaking instrumentals. As one third of The Juggaknots and through previous solo work, she’s more than proven herself as a force in the world of Hip-Hop. But ATSG is simply on another level—and its release was well worth the wait.  

After dropping her debut, Metamorphosis, in 2015, Queen Herawin moved from NYC to Chicago and put out an EP, The Space Between Things. And upon returning to New York she hit a creative wall and began to internalize her feelings and thoughts. Eventually, those emotions that she had turned a blind eye to emerged to tell the story of an awakening. Queen Herawin brings those feelings to life in the form of both track titles and jaw-dropping lyricism, and she gets right to the point on the opener, “Focus.” A gut-punch of writing, the song is also a flat-out banger thanks to Bear-One’s production. It sets the tone for the rest of the record, too, as Herawin moves through emotions like “Anger,” “Denial,” and “Shame” with an unmatched pen game. But she also makes room for bravado and culling self-doubt on standout tracks “Arrogant (feat. Poison Pen)” and “Manifest (feat. Apathy & Mickey Factz).”  

“The album is a musical memoir,” Queen Herawin explains. “It’s about acceptance, but also awakening to the things I wanted to bring awareness to.” Most importantly, ATSG represents Queen Herawin’s journey and personal growth, and she hopes it will have a similar effect on listeners.
